CLuB Researchers present at conferences in the USA and Greece

Faye Lewis at AACR

CLuB researchers recently presented their work at events in the USA and Greece. Faye Lewis presented her work on circulating tumour cells in high-grade serous ovarian carcinomas at the American Association for Cancer Research (AACR) Special Conference in Ovarian Cancer Research in Denver, Colorado.

L-R: Christina Cahill and Volga Saini at ACTC

Christina Cahill, Volga Saini and Kathy Gately attended the 7th Advances in Circulating Tumour Cells (ACTC) meeting in Thessaloniki, Greece where they presented posters on evaluation of circulating tumour cell recovery rate using the Genesis system for rare cell isolation; and on the enumeration and characterisation of circulating tumour cells and mesenchymal cells in longitudinal blood samples from patients with resectable lung cancer.
